March 3-8, 2019. Workshop at Lublin University of Technology
On the basis of Lublin University of Technology was held another workshop on the project Erasmus+ TRUNAK "Transition to University autonomy in Kazakhstan".
From March 3 to 8, issues related to management, academic, financial, personnel autonomy of universities were discussed on the example of universities in Europe with the possibility of implementing existing developments in the universities of Kazakhstan. Specialists of universities, such European countries as Poland, Italy, Great Britain, Finland, presented their existing systems of University autonomy, advised on issues of interest. For example, quite interesting was the speech of the Deputy Dean of the University of Ljubljana Tomas Mars. It was devoted to management, academic and financial independence at the level of a single faculty.
Carolina Galazka, financial auditor of Loot, presented a model of financing universities in Poland. It is interesting that out of 100% of the students enrolled, 60-70% graduate and receive diplomas, which is an indicator of the high requirements for students and the quality of education. Stephanie Bruno, from the faculty of health of the Catholic University of the sacred heart in Rome, was a consultant to the workshop on the quality of education in Italy, in particular the evaluation of research and didactics: information on the national Agency for the evaluation of universities and research institutes ANVUR, working as a body of the Ministry of Education. Enora Bennett also presented a report of the European Association of universities on the transition to University autonomy in Kazakhstan.
The task of the group in Lublin was to review the work of previous workshops and to develop its proposals and recommendations. Participants of the workshop participated in the international seminar "Bioinformatics 2019". Demonstrated equipment to capture human movement can be widely used in medicine.
